Banquet canceled, but finalists announced for North Idaho Athletic Hall of Fame awards
COEUR d’ALENE — The good news — athletes, teams and coaches from 25 high schools and three colleges in North Idaho has been selected as finalists for the annual North Idaho Athletic Hall of Fame awards, officials announced Saturday.
The bad news — because of the safety recommendations by the Center for Disease Control in dealing with the COVID-19 coronavirus, officials have canceled the 58th annual North Idaho Athletic Hall of Fame banquet and induction ceremonies scheduled for April 25 at The Coeur d’Alene Resort.
Instead, the five individuals scheduled to be inducted will wait a year and be honored at the 2021 banquet. The previously announced five inductees are former University of Idaho women’s basketball player Emily Sann (nee Faurholt) and former Vandal football players Jason Shelt and Robert Young, former Coeur d’Alene High and University of Montana standout Ann Jaworski (nee Schwenke), and longtime high school teacher, coach, administrator and basketball official Jim Wilund.
The North Idaho Hall of Fame also honors District I-II high school athletes, coaches and teams for their outstanding play, along with the athletes, coaches and teams from the University of Idaho, North Idaho College and Lewis-Clark State College. The awards cover the 2019 academic spring season and the 2019-20 academic fall and winter seasons.
Nominations for each category are reviewed by the Hall of Fame committee, which selects finalists for each category. A winner is then selected. Winners are normally announced at the banquet, but this year will be released through the media to announce on Sunday, April 26.
Each finalist receives a certificate and the winners also receive a plaque. The athlete, coach and team of the year awards for both high school and college receive trophies. These awards also are handed out during the banquet, but Hall of Fame officials are working on how to distribute them this year and will be working with athletic directors and principals at the schools on determining the best methods.
Anyone who bought tickets online for this year’s banquet should receive an email notice of their refund.
